Those 2 bugs are not same at all... we are talking a ThinkPad T430 with only a integrated GPU, that lags on some website vs a dedicated gpu that can't use EGL and falls back to software rendering, as seen here: JOURNAL LOG: kwin_wayland: Error creating EGLImageKHR: "EGL_BAD_MATCH" kwin_wayland: Could not delete render time query because no context is current those are 2 separate things, is it the same underlaying topic, yes both are about EGL but the contexts are what differ the 2. Also the reproduction differ too, on this bug here it is about a EGL_BAD_MATCH that occurs during dmabuf buffer import between my 2 devices (dGPU Intel Arc A770 using the xe driver and iGPU Intel UHD 770 using the i915 driver). This is not about website rendering performance but a driver issue on the Arc A770. - Bjorn. -- You are receiving this mail because: You are watching all bug changes.
